## Action Item: Nightly Reindex Guardrails

Owner: search platform. The Tolvera reindex overran its window twice because batch sizes were hand-edited on the indexer host and never committed. Fix: move all reindex pacing into config, reviewed like code. Add an alert when the job exceeds 80% of its window. Kill switch stays manual for now. Effective next cycle, the job runs with the committed constants shown below.

constants for bawep-fajog:
RATE_LIMITS = {
    "oliath": 2,
    "wenix": 5,
    "quenael": 5,
    "ralix": 2,
}

Action item 7 (owner: relevance team, due end of sprint): consolidate the search relevance tuning notes for Findable, our internal search service. During the incident, responders could not locate the current boost-weight rationale, which delayed rollback of the faulty ranking change by forty minutes. Because tuning parameters can leak inferences about document sensitivity tiers, the consolidated notes require a security review before broader access is granted. The draft has been assembled and is awaiting your review at the internal page below.

operations page: https://confluence.qorvellabs.internal/pages/projects/projects/projects

// Fixture: password reset flow revamp (Project Latchkey)
// Support note: these tests mirror what customers see after the October
// rollout. Reset links now expire in 15 minutes instead of 24 hours,
// and a confirmation email fires on completion. If a customer reports
// a dead link, check the expiry first. The mock mailer records every
// message for inspection. Tests call the Latchkey sandbox, which
// authenticates using the bearer token below.

login token, bagug-kafop: eyJhbGciOiJIUzI1NiIsInR5cCI6IkpXVCJ9.eyJzdWIiOiIcMLov2In0.Z5RLDIfp